The Role:

Cornwall Council are looking for a forward thinking, enthusiastic, self-motivated and skilled Senior Electoral Officer within our Elections team.  You will be contributing to the lives of Cornwall residents by ensuring our community’s participation in the democratic process.  You will be working in the heart of a team that administers the organisation of all elections and referendums within Cornwall along with the registration of voters, the annual canvass and compilation of the electoral register.  For the organisation of elections, you will be mainly concerned with one of our six constituencies.

This is a public/customer-facing role, where the statutory English language requirement for public sector workers applies.

Working Pattern:

The working pattern is 37 hours per week, Monday to Friday, on a hybrid basis working either at our Truro Offices or at home.  During busy periods such as major elections you may be required to work some evenings and weekends (overtime or flexi time will be paid/accrued for this)

What you’ll need to succeed:

Ideally, you will have achieved a professional qualification at Association of Electoral Administrator Certificate level, have a good understanding of current legislation and best practice within the election world and be able to perform to a high standard and with a high attention to detail.
